rockchip: rk3399: Add Orangepi RK3399 support

Add initial support for Orangepi RK3399 board.

Specification
- Rockchip RK3399
- 2GB/4GB DDR3
- 16GB eMMC
- SD card slot
- RTL8211E 1Gbps
- AP6356S WiFI/BT
- HDMI In/Out, DP, MIPI DSI/CSI
- Mini PCIe
- Sensors, Keys etc
- DC12V-2A and DC5V-2A

Commit details about Linux DTS sync:
"arm64: dts: rockchip: Add support for the Orange Pi RK3399"
(sha1: d3e71487a790979057c0fdbf32f85033639c16e6)
